Overview

mbcfx was founded in 2021 and is headquartered in Puerto Rico, while Valbury Capital was established in 2008 and is based in UK. Both brokers are regulated by Financial Conduct Authority (FCA), among other authorities. mbcfx serves 30,000+ clients worldwide; Valbury Capital has 10,000+. The minimum deposit is $250 at mbcfx and $15000 at Valbury Capital.

Deposits & Withdrawals

Convenient deposit and withdrawal options reduce friction for traders, especially important when managing positions across time zones. mbcfx accepts 5 of the tracked payment methods (bank transfer, credit/debit card, PayPal, Skrill, Neteller), while Valbury Capital supports 2 (bank transfer, credit/debit card). mbcfx uniquely supports PayPal and Skrill and Neteller among the two brokers. mbcfx scores higher on deposit and withdrawal flexibility.
